Disaster in Haiti

People in the nation of Haiti are struggling to recover after a powerful earthquake caused massive destruction there.Tens of thousands of people in the Caribbean nation were killed, and many more were injured. The Presidential Palace, which is like the White House here in the U.S., was among the many government buildings that collapsed. Hospitals were destroyed, as were countless homes. The disaster added more suffering to people already struggling to cope with everyday life.

Haiti is one of the poorest nations in the world so international aid groups are rushing to provide food, water, and medical aid to Haiti. People worldwide are donating money to help. Many nations, including the U.S., are sending aid as well as money. The U.S. is sending troops to help with rescue and relief efforts, and to police the streets.

Home Run for Hispanic Heritage

As a child, Roberto was a gifted player and a big fan of baseball. His years of practice paid off. He was recruited for Puerto Rico's amateur league while still in high school.In 1954, he was drafted into the Major League and joined the Pittsburgh Pirates. He moved to Pennsylvania and stayed with the same team for almost 20 years.

Early in his career, Clemente was among many Hispanic athletes who had to cope with racism. At games, fans sometimes yelled racist insults at him ム and so did some of his teammates. But he brushed it off. "I don't believe in color," Clemente once told reporters.In time, Clemente became one of the sport's most celebrated stars. He was the first Hispanic American to earn a World Series ring as a starting player in 1960, to win the Most Valuable Player (MVP) award in 1966, and the World Series MVP award, in 1971.

After his death in 1972, Clemente was honored as the first Hispanic American to be voted into Major League Baseball's Hall of Fame. Although his career and life were cut short, Clemente helped change American attitudes about Hispanics in professional sports ム on and off the field.
